BUS 171: Information Systems and Operations
3.00 Credits
Chatham University
This course explores basic concepts of communication networks (e.g., the Internet), hardware, software, databases, and systems. Students apply information systems to decision making, communication, collaboration and coordination in the operations of contemporary organizations. Students gain skills in word processing, presentation software, data visualization, spreadsheets, and relational databases.

BUS 202: Principles of Sport Management
3.00 Credits
Chatham University
This course provides an introduction to the sport management industry. Students will examine sport industry segments, professions and skills needed to meet the challenges of today's business of sport. Critical analysis of women in sport will be a core component of this course as we examine such topics as professional sport, intercollegiate athletics, community sport, finance and economics in sport, sport marketing and event management.

BUS 230: Organizational Behavior
3.00 Credits
Chatham University
This course teaches students to understand, explain, and improve human behavior in organizations. Most organizations focus efforts on improving job performance and organizational commitment. The purpose of this course is to provide a theoretical foundation and realistic understanding of how human behavior influences the effectiveness of the modern corporation.

BUS 240: International Business
3.00 Credits
Chatham University
This course provides the background on the relationships among multinational corporations, international financial markets, and government agencies. Multinational corporations' strategic formulations of product policy research and development, production, and supply systems, as well as financing of international operations, are examined. This course fulfills a global general education mission requirement.
Prerequisite:
BUS105

BUS 243: Principles of Marketing
3.00 Credits
Chatham University
This course introduces students to the basic concepts of marketing strategy and management. Basic marketing concepts such as strategic segmentation, targeting, positioning, product design, pricing, promotions and distribution are covered. Environmental sustainability is analyzed from the consumer perspective.
Prerequisite:
BUS105

BUS 244: Consumer Behavior
3.00 Credits
Chatham University
The course reviews and evaluates the major theories of consumer behavior from the economics, behavioral sciences, and marketing literatures. The use of consumer research data for marketing decisions is emphasized. Topics include market segmentation, theories of brand choice, family decision making, life cycle theories, and the diffusion of innovations.
Prerequisite:
BUS243
